Akiko Ishikawa is a scholar working on Surgery, Molecular Biology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Akiko Ishikawa has authored 49 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Surgery, 12 papers in Molecular Biology and 7 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Akiko Ishikawa's work include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(4 papers) and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(4 papers). Akiko Ishikawa is often cited by papers focused on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(4 papers) and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(4 papers). Akiko Ishikawa coll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Netherlands. Akiko Ishikawa's co-authors include Hideaki Tsuji, Katsuya Maruyama, Nobuyoshi Nakajima, Kohji Ishihara, Tomoki Sumida, Yoshiyuki Takahashi, Yuji Nakamura, Shigenari Hozawa, Isao Okazaki and Maki Niioka and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and Gastroenterology.
